Background
The tube winding machine is an apparatus for manufacturing bobbins, in which cloth is rolled into a tubular shape by a tube winding machine to produce bobbins, and the types of the tube winding machine are various, and the most common tube winding machines are a spiral tube winding machine and a flat tube winding machine
When the bobbin is manufactured by the conventional tube winding machine, cloth needs to be wound on a cylinder of the tube winding machine firstly, then the tube winding machine is started to wind the cloth into a large cylinder, so that the bobbin is manufactured, when the cloth is just placed on the cylinder, because the tube winding machine is not provided with a device capable of fixing the cloth, the cloth needs to be pressed on the cylinder by a hand, the hand can be loosened after the cloth is wound for several circles, and further the process of winding the cloth on the cylinder is too troublesome, so that the tube winding machine with the function of fixing the cloth is developed by the problems.

In the embodiment, as shown in fig. 1 to 5, a bobbin winding device for bobbin processing includes a control box 1 and a fixing device 6, wherein one side of the control box 1 is rotatably connected with a rotating shaft 5, a cylinder 3 is fixedly installed on the rotating shaft 5, a first limiting disc 2 is fixedly connected to the surface of the rotating shaft 5, and a second limiting disc 4 is sleeved on the rotating shaft 5.
The specific arrangement and function of the fixing means 6 and the mounting means 7 will be described in detail below.
As shown in fig. 2 and 3, a fixing device 6 is disposed on one side of the first limiting disc 2 and the second limiting disc 4, which are away from each other, the fixing device 6 includes two rectangular grooves 612, the two rectangular grooves 612 are respectively disposed on the first limiting disc 2 and the second limiting disc 4, a fixing block 610 is fixedly connected to an inner wall of the rectangular groove 612, a positioning rod 611 is penetratingly disposed in the fixing block 610, a circular disc 608 is fixedly disposed at one end of the positioning rod 611, which is away from the cylinder 3, a first spring 609 is fixedly connected between the circular disc 608 and the fixing block 610, a connecting plate 607 is fixedly disposed at one end of the fixing block 610, which is away from the rotating shaft 5, the connecting plate 607 is L-shaped, and a limiting column 602 is vertically penetratingly inserted at a long arm end of the connecting plate 607.
A threaded rod 604 is inserted into one side of the connecting plate 607, and the threaded rod 604 is inserted into the limiting column 602 in a threaded manner.
A rope 603 is fixedly arranged at one end, far away from the circular disc 608, of the limiting column 602, a circular ring 605 is fixedly connected at one end, far away from the limiting column 602, of the rope 603, a connecting column 606 is fixedly arranged at one side, close to the circular ring 605, of the connecting plate 607, and the circular ring 605 is sleeved on the connecting column 606.
The side of the connecting plate 607 far away from the threaded rod 604 is fixedly provided with a supporting plate 601, and the supporting plate 601 is in an L shape.
The effect achieved by the entire fixing device 6 is that, when a cloth is to be fixed on the cylinder 3, the threaded rod 604 is rotated so that the threaded rod 604 slides out of the retaining post 602, then the ring 605 is pulled so that the string 603 pulls the retaining post 602, the retaining post 602 is moved away from the front of the disc 608, then the ring 605 is put on the connecting post 606, then the disc 608 is pulled so that the disc 608 pulls the retaining rod, then the ring 605 is taken off the connecting post 606, then the retaining post 602 is pushed so that the retaining post 602 blocks the disc 608, then the threaded rod 604 is reversed so that the threaded rod 604 comes into contact with the disc 608, then the cloth is put on the cylinder 3, the threaded rod 604 is rotated so that the threaded rod 604 slides out of the retaining post 602, then the retaining post 602 is pulled so that the retaining post 602 no longer comes into contact with the disc 608, so that the first spring 609 pulls the disc 608 because of its elasticity, disc 608 can promote locating lever 611 this moment, make locating lever 611 push down the cloth on drum 3, thereby make cloth fix in pivot 5, the effect of fixing cloth on drum 3 has been played, pass through control box 1 this moment, make cloth winding on drum 3, after the winding is accomplished, spur locating lever 611, make locating lever 611 take out from the cloth, through setting up fixing device 6, can fix cloth on drum 3, avoided cloth to have just laid on drum 3, it presses cloth on drum 3 to need the staff, avoid cloth to drop from drum 3, then just can start the reelpipe machine and twine cloth on drum 3, the winding efficiency of cloth has been improved, make the setting of this fixing device 6 have more the practicality.
As shown in fig. 1 and 4, a mounting device 7 is disposed on one side of the second limiting disc 4 away from the cylinder 3, the mounting device 7 includes a fixing plate 77, the fixing plate 77 is fixedly mounted on the second limiting disc 4, a round rod 78 is penetratingly disposed in the fixing plate 77, the round rod 78 is inserted in the rotating shaft 5, a pushing block 74 is fixedly mounted on one end of the round rod 78 away from the rotating shaft 5, the pushing block 74 is in a right triangle shape, and a second spring 76 is fixedly connected between the pushing block 74 and the fixing plate 77.
A rectangular plate 75 is fixedly mounted on one side of the fixing plate 77 away from the second limiting disc 4, and a push rod 71 penetrates through the rectangular plate 75.
An inserting rod 73 is inserted into one side of the rectangular plate 75, the inserting rod 73 is inserted into the push rod 71, a magnetic plate 72 is fixedly mounted at one end, far away from the rectangular plate 75, of the inserting rod 73, and one end, close to the inserting rod 73, of the magnetic plate 72 is magnetically attracted with the rectangular plate 75.
The whole installation device 7 achieves the effects that the inserting rod 73 is pulled firstly, so that the inserting rod 73 slides out of the push rod 71, at the same time, the push rod 71 is pulled, so that the push rod 71 slides on the inclined surface of the push block 74, at the same time, the push rod 71 slides to one side far away from the push block 74, so that the second spring 76 pushes the push block 74 due to the recovery of the elastic force, at the same time, the round rod 78 slides along with the push block 74, so that the round rod 78 slides out of the rotating shaft 5, then the second limiting disc 4 is taken down from the rotating shaft 5, the effect of detaching the second limiting disc 4 is achieved, when the second limiting disc 4 needs to be installed on the rotating shaft 5, the second limiting disc 4 is sleeved on the rotating shaft 5, at the same time, the inserting rod 73 is pulled, so that the inserting rod 73 slides out of the push rod 71, then the push rod 71 is pushed, so that the push block 74 is pushed by the push rod 71, at the round rod 78 slides into the rotating shaft 5 by means of the thrust of the push rod 71, then promote inserted bar 73 for inserted bar 73 inserts in the push rod 71, magnetic sheet 72 can contact and magnetism with rectangular plate 75 this moment, thereby make spacing dish 4 of second fix with the help of the joint of round bar 78 and pivot 5, through setting up installation device 7, can be quick dismantle spacing dish 4 of second, when having avoided cloth to accomplish processing on drum 3 and forming the spool, need dismantle spacing dish 4 of second, just can take off the spool from pivot 5, because spacing dish 4 of second, generally all install on pivot 5 with the help of the nut, and then the process that leads to dismantling is too loaded down with trivial details, make the setting of this installation device 7 more important.
